Travelling with Topamax: practical tips — for Italy
Travel raises specific medication questions that rarely come up at home: time-zone shifts, customs rules, packing in carry-on vs hold luggage, and what to do if Topamax runs out abroad. Topamax (Topiramate) is straightforward to travel with at 25mg, 50mg, 100mg, 200mg as long as a few practical points are covered.
Italy context
Travelling with Topamax into or out of Italy is generally straightforward when the medication is in original packaging with a copy of the prescription. AIFA (Agenzia Italiana del Farmaco) enforces personal-use rules in line with international standards; for prolonged stays, sourcing additional Topiramate locally through a licensed pharmacy is usually preferable to importing from elsewhere.

Packing and customs
Topamax should travel in its original packaging with the prescription label visible. Most countries allow personal-use quantities of Topamax for the duration of the trip plus a buffer. According to most pharmacy travel guidance, keeping a copy of the prescription and a brief note from the prescriber on the active ingredient Topiramate avoids problems at customs.
Time zones and continuity
For daily Topamax at 25mg, 50mg, 100mg, 200mg, small time-zone shifts (1–3 hours) usually need no schedule change — take the dose at the new local time. Large shifts (5+ hours) can use a single transitional gap or shift dose timing by an hour per day until the new schedule is established. Frequently asked questions
Can I take Topamax through airport security? ▾
Yes, Topamax in its original packaging at 25mg, 50mg, 100mg, 200mg is allowed in carry-on luggage in nearly all jurisdictions. Liquids may be subject to volume rules but tablets are not. Keep a copy of the prescription label visible in case of questions.
What if I run out of Topamax abroad? ▾
Most countries have local equivalents of the active ingredient Topiramate, sometimes under different brand names. A pharmacist or local doctor can supply a short course; some destinations require a fresh local prescription. Bring a buffer pack to reduce the risk of running out before travel ends.
